Use of cannabis in Guadeloupe

Cannabis in Guadeloupe is: illegal. But is cultivated. And transported illicitly. A 2007 report noted the: prevalence of cannabis among youth in Guadeloupe at 7%.
Trafficking※
Cannabis grown on the——Windward Islands is transported to Guadeloupe, "where it commands a higher price." Guadeloupe is located amongst several major cannabis producers. And thus serves as an entry point to the cannabis markets in Europe and "North America."
